Sistrah

As the distributor of Poul Henningsen's PH lighting range in Germany, Otto Muller decided to produce his own version of these highly successful lights. Manufactured under the Sistrah trademark It was Otto Müller, who, in close tandem with the students at the ‘Institute of Light technology of the Technical University of Karlsruhe’ developed the lamps. Mullers designs were the Teutonic equivalent of the PH lighting system. The idea behind their design was to make the bulb invisable in order to create a dazzle free light. From their inception in 1931 Sistrah and Muller produced a range of lighting from desk lamps, pendant lamps, medical lamps, billiard lamps and even street lamps. Their clever branding slogan ‘Sie strahlt hell’ (She burns brightly)(SISTRAH), their annual catalogues and the amazing built quality made Sistrah the lamp of choice for many business owners.
